Output 8ecf6112c74f18ff8431b0ae6e43aab5d37b273a7086c0e29a1551bbb001c323:4

value
140000
script pubkey
OP_0 OP_PUSHBYTES_20 50d1b9f96b24130e9afcbaa6aa44b9b4b3284512
address
bc1q2rgmn7ttysfsaxhuh2n2539ekjejs3gjatspgk
transaction
8ecf6112c74f18ff8431b0ae6e43aab5d37b273a7086c0e29a1551bbb001c323
spent
true